Specialty Imaging Technologist - CT Scan

HealthcareFull-time

Position Summary

Performs diagnostic exams on patients in the specialized areas of mammography, computed tomography, and special procedures. Uses specialized equipment, techniques and/or computer programs to perform the work.

Job Requirement

  • Education/Experience: Successful completion of an AMA approved Radiologic Technology Program.
  • Licensing/Certification Requirements: State of Nevada License in Radiology. Valid American Registry of Radiology Technologists (ARRT) Registered in Radiography; National Certification in specialty area such as Computed Tomography or Angiography. Basic Life Support (BLS) certification accepted by the American Heart Association (AHA).
  • Additional Position Requirements: Preferences will be given to applicants who document the following: Valid State of Nevada License in Radiology; Valid American Registry of Radiology Technologist (ARRT) Registered in Computed Tomography; Previous 3 (three) years experience in performing CT exams in a Trauma setting and; CT interventional exams on patients.

Knowledge Of

  • Procedures and protocols associated with area of assignment;
  • Specialized equipment used in area of assignment;
  • Radiography protocols and procedures;
  • Quality assurance and quality control measures;
  • Personal computers;
  • Anatomy and physiology of the human body;
  • Contrast application and contrast reaction symptoms;
  • Venipuncture techniques;
  • Department and hospital safety practices and principles;
  • Patient rights;
  • Age specific patient care practices;
  • Infection control policies and practices;
  • Handling, storage, use and disposal of hazardous materials;
  • Department and hospital emergency response policies and procedures.

Skill In

  • Utilizing computers and specialized application software for scanning and diagnostic evaluation;
  • Utilizing specialized equipment and techniques for diagnostic evaluation;
  • Applying aseptic techniques;
  • Positioning patients properly to maximize results;
  • Communicating with a wide variety of people from diverse socio-economic and ethnic backgrounds;
  • Establishing and maintaining effective working relationships with all personnel contacted in the course of duties;
  • Efficient, effective and safe use of equipment.

Physical Requirements And Working Conditions

  • Mobility to work in a typical clinical setting and use standard equipment;
  • Stamina to remain standing and/or walk for extended periods of time;
  • Vision to read printed materials and VDT screens;
  • Hearing and speech to communicate effectively in-person and over the telephone;
  • Strength and agility to exert up to 100 pounds of force occasionally, and/or up to 50 pounds of force frequently, and/or up to 20 pounds of force constantly to move objects.
